What is ClearCue?+
ClearCue is a set of timing tools for video editing. It helps you see timing relationships, make structure explicit, and use that structure however your workflow requires.
What is FrameFit?+
FrameFit helps you understand the relationship between frame rate, tempo and timing. It shows which timing relationships align cleanly with your timeline and where drift or uneven spacing may occur.
What is TimeVisualiser?+
TimeVisualiser turns timing structures into reusable TimeObjects (visual guides) that you can place directly on your editing timeline. They make pacing, subdivisions, and timing relationships visible while you work.
Do I need to use FrameFit and TimeVisualiser together?+
No. Each tool can be useful independently. FrameFit helps you understand timing relationships; TimeVisualiser lets you turn a chosen structure into something you can work with directly on your timeline.

Can I use more than one timing structure in an edit?+
Yes. Timing guides are reusable media assets, so you can place multiple structures on different tracks and use them for different purposes, such as pacing, captions, picture changes, music, or other events.
Can I use ClearCue with beat detection?+
Yes. They solve different problems. Beat detection identifies events in existing audio; ClearCue can provide a broader timing structure around which those events, and the rest of the edit, can be organised.

Which editing software is supported?+
TimeVisualiser exports standard MP4 TimeObjects, so they can be used in any modern NLE that supports MP4 media, including DaVinci Resolve, Premiere Pro, and Final Cut Pro.
We recommend using Resolve for best performance (markers on the TimeObject clip).
Why is DaVinci Resolve recommended?+
TimeVisualiser can take advantage of Resolve's marker support as well as standard visual timing guides, giving Resolve users additional ways to work with the generated structure.
What does TimeVisualiser generate?+
TimeVisualiser generates reusable MP4 TimeObjects containing visible timing markers (Resolve). These can be placed on your timeline, duplicated, moved, stacked, and reused like other media.
What is the duration/length of a TimeObject?+
TimeObjects have a length of 15s. As they are MP4s, they can be copied and repeated like any video clip.
Do the TimeObjects contain audio?+
They include a click reference, allowing the timing structure to be heard as well as seen. In Final Cut or Premiere, use the frame-accurate transients to place markers.

Is ClearCue AI?+
No. ClearCue's timing tools are deterministic. They use well-defined mathematical relationships to analyse and generate timing structures rather than relying on generative AI.
